Transaction 57dfedb449c8bd351f47e21905b82427088f94686de4909ef4336aace8eba180

1 Input
2 Outputs
  • 57dfedb449c8bd351f47e21905b82427088f94686de4909ef4336aace8eba180:0
  • value  52411661
    address  32mQufNEQpbcwWRWJMmc112VQ2NLya81kH
  • 57dfedb449c8bd351f47e21905b82427088f94686de4909ef4336aace8eba180:1
  • value  59950000
    address  12SqWznhughbVPMDqdgUafDvRSV3T9CqjA